Awesome place. We had Site 140 with our 29 foot travel trailer. Can’t get much closer to beach. Sites are tight but like I said the proximity to the beach makes up for it completely. Everything is clean, people are friendly. Ice cream, restaurant, pier, beach , fishing , gift shop are all on site. Tanger outlets are around the corner. But my favorite thing of all, 5 days during Spring Break in Myrtle beach all for around $300. We will definitely be back this summer.

The description of the Vacation Rentals says “These units are fully furnished and equipped with all the amenities”. However, deep into the ‘reservation policy’ pages after the paragraphs on no pets and no smoking it says “ Please be aware that our Leisure Living Vacation Rentals do not include linens, pillow covers, or extra blankets. ” Didn’t think we’d have to make a trip to Walmart for sheets and towels before going to bed! This should be clearly stated and not buried in the fine print.
